移動端的數據輸入與存儲

1 評論 15049 瀏覽 274 收藏 13 分鐘

數據的輸入、存儲與數據的檢索是數據管理中非常重要的一部分。當我們拿起手機,我們時時刻刻都在進行著輸入操作,設備也在不斷的存儲我們輸入的數據。這里主要討論輸入和存儲這兩部分。

輸入

移動端輸入可以簡單的分為三個部分:判斷式輸入、字段式輸入以及綜合式輸入。

2-0

先舉幾個簡單的例子,比如微信中看見覺得好玩有趣的東西,順便點個贊;比如美團中看中某家餐廳正在大力優惠,然后趕緊添加收藏;以及tinder開創的左滑右滑分別代表喜歡和跳過的瀏覽方式等。

2-1舉例一

這些都相當于數據的輸入,因為這些判斷式的操作都將直接關聯進我們的賬號中,你會發現假如你沒有登陸的話,收藏、喜歡等功能都是沒法正常使用的。而且這些數據一般都可以在我們的個人主頁找到記錄,比如美團中有一個查看我的收藏功能,在這里可以查看到之前收藏過的店面;或則默認在系統中記錄但并不顯示出來,比如網易云音樂我們跳過了一首歌,系統將記錄下你的行為,并在你的賬號下留下一個記錄,以便于網易云推薦的音樂更加符合你的口味。

將這種輸入的形式稱為判斷式輸入,主要是因為它僅僅是一個是與否的判斷,比如點贊,你只能選擇贊或則不贊。這種方式常見于內容列表的展示中,用于快速的記錄數據,相當于做了一個簡單的記號??梢灶惐扔谖覀兩钪锌磿鴷r,覺得哪里比較好,折一個角便于以后查詢。

這種形式的優勢還是十分明顯的,因為它具有易理解、操作簡便等特點,對于某些需要快速標記的地方能起到很好的效果。但由于只有是與不是的兩種選擇,限制還是很大的,很多情況下并不能僅僅用是與不是來做一個簡單的數據輸入。

2-0-2

同樣也先舉幾個例子,比如注冊一個社交軟件,首先要給自己一個昵稱;比如在購買車票的時候,要先選擇出發和到達的地點;還有像想要查看某個地方離自己的距離,打開百度地圖,然后輸入一個地址。

2-1舉例二

這些數據的輸入都屬于一個相應特征的字段,而且一般比較短,比如昵稱代表的是用戶在該軟件中的名字,而在購票軟件中輸入的出發地點對應的則是出發地點這個字段。

對于這類數據輸入,有2種常見的形式。第一種是不限制輸入的內容,比如昵稱,用戶可以任意的選擇字母文字數字以及符號的組合來作為自己的昵稱,這種方式相對而言可控性比較低,但我覺得一款數字軟件本身就應該給予用戶更多的權利,系統給予適當的審核即可。

而對于審核這里順便提及一下先后問題,假如對于輸入的數據需要審核,那么審核應該盡可能的提前。當用戶并不愿意仔細的閱讀規則的時候,這一點尤其重要,可以想象一下當用戶輸入了好幾個字段的內容之后,點擊了下一步,系統突然彈出提醒說您的第一個字段不符合規則,請重新填寫,這種感覺就像用戶剛剛覺得自己快要沖刺到達終點了,卻被突然取消了參賽資格。那么盡可能的提前審核,將讓用戶更加清楚這些規則,一步一步的走向終點。那么是否要清空錯誤的信息呢?對于這個問題,我個人認為不應該清空,因為系統負責的僅僅是審核,不應該被賦予編輯的權利,但可以提供給用戶一鍵清空的途徑。

第二種是限制輸入的內容,比如許多社交軟件為了讓用戶更好的匹配到興趣相似的朋友,會在注冊后彈出一個頁面詢問用戶對哪些東西感興趣,然后列出一系列的興趣標簽,比如二次元、動漫、美劇、NBA、跑車等等。這就是一種限制型的輸入,用戶無法自己提交感興趣的內容,只能在提供的標簽中進行選擇。這樣做的好處是,可控性非常強,減少了軟件匹配系統的壓力,匹配也將更加的精準,避免出現一些無厘頭的標簽。而在百度地圖中,如果想要尋找相應的地點,軟件提供了一個輔助性的功能,就是在用戶輸入的同時會提供相應的聯想詞提供參考,這也是另一種限制輸入的方式,不僅可以讓用戶更快的輸入自己想要輸入的內容,而且也避免了一些不正式的自然語言的影響。但不正式的自然語言在生活中隨處發生,比如打的說要去某個電影院,有時我們會對司機說『帶我們去靠近步行街的那個老一點的電影院』。這話老司機一般都懂,但對于一臺機器而言,它可能并不懂這些。

2-0-3

綜合式輸入,比如突然有了感慨,想發一段文字在朋友圈;比如在一個攝影社區中,把自己今天拍的一張好看的照片po了上去;又或者在一個寫作平臺,發表了一篇自己對于生活的對于愛情的看法。

2-1舉例三

這種數據輸入的形式,不同于前面,綜合性比較強,不再僅僅是文字而已,可以添加圖片、視頻以及音頻等等。而且往往輸入的都是較長的內容。常見于筆記工具類、閱讀類以及社交類的應用中。

它的優勢顯而易見,可以包容各種形式的內容,但同樣也是最復雜的數據輸入,因為涉及到諸如文字的各種格式的修改、圖片的格式的限制、圖文的排版形式、視頻的大小限制等等。往往用戶在做這種綜合式輸入的時候,界面上往往都會有很多輔助型的工具,但移動端的界面畢竟有限,如何讓用戶更好的在移動端進行輸入,是一個需要深入考慮的事情。比如常見的功能盡量放在用戶操作更加方便的地方,一些不太常用的功能進行相應的折疊。對于不同類別的功能,利用視覺上的分離,使它們組成不同的功能組合,便于用戶的理解。

存儲

數據進行了輸入那么緊接著就是如何存儲,相比于pc端,移動端在存儲方面做了很多改良,引用一段about face中的話:

IOS之類的移動操作系統將文件和創建該文件的應用緊密地關聯起來,要使用文檔,就必須打開創建文檔的應用,才能訪問文檔。一旦適應了這種以應用為中心的范式,事情就簡單多了。

回想一下在pc端找文件,我們需要清楚的記得文件放在了什么地方,如果遺忘了關鍵的信息,可能就再也無法找到這個文件。而移動端將文件與應用相關聯,我們在使用相應的文件時,就可以很方便的打開相應的應用,然后找到對應格式的要找的內容。當然對于少數幾種文檔類型,比如圖片、音樂等,是可以在整個系統中進行方便的調用查看的。

在移動端,由于不同的內容是關聯相應的應用的,要在其他的應用中調用,可以通過不同軟件的分享功能,但常見的分享都是針對于那幾個主要的社交應用,有一些閱讀類應用稍有不同,不僅支持分享到社交應用,還可以分享到各種稍后閱讀以及筆記類軟件中,扯遠了,拉回來。

移動端存儲還有一個顯著的特點就是對于云的應用,由于谷歌在這一領域的領導作用,很多基于云的應用可以自動存儲,免去了用戶的擔憂和困擾。而且隨著云技術的不斷提高,以及網絡速度的不斷提升,存儲將越來越多的從本地傳輸到云中,利用云可以實現跨屏式的自由工作,在多個設備中都可以查看到保存在云端的文件,方便快捷。而且將用戶的信息從多個設備中轉移到同一個云賬戶下存儲,比如用戶的手機設備、Pc端、各種物聯網設備上的數據做一個整合分析,這樣提供給用戶將是一個全新的體驗,成為一個強力的云端管家,幫助用戶處理各種事務提升效率。

除了上面兩個比較顯著的移動端特點以外,關于存儲還可以探討很多通常的問題,比如自動存儲問題,在使用word的時候,我們經常會遇見寫了一個文件以后,點擊關閉,這時會彈出一個提示框,詢問是否需要保存。對于這個問題,選擇是的人數應該是要遠遠大于選擇否的,那么這個提示框是否應該出現就是一個值得討論的問題了。我認為既然用戶已經付出了時間和精力去寫下一段內容,這段內容必然是有它的價值的,所以作為一個草稿保存下來是理所應當的。就好比在拍照的時候,在預覽框中已經取景完畢,按下了快門鍵,這時系統詢問你是否要保存剛才所拍的照片,想必對于留住美好瞬間的喜悅感將被這樣的問題所摧毀。幸好大部分應用都加上了自動存儲的功能,避免了用戶的努力付之一炬,像微信朋友圈po狀態,如果恰好來了一條消息,回了消息以后還能繼續編輯原先寫下的內容;還有知乎回答某個問題,如果沒有選擇發布而退出編輯,這個回答將自動的保存為草稿,方便用戶后續的使用。

最后對于移動端數據的輸入與存儲,我可能也只是談了一小部分,如果大家有什么想要探討的,歡迎和我繼續探討。

 

本文系作者@thor 投稿發布, 未經許可,不得轉載。

更多精彩內容,請關注人人都是產品經理微信公眾號或下載App
評論
評論請登錄
  1. 關于記賬類、飲食記錄類的移動端APP,有沒有好分享的?歡迎交流啊~

    來自廣東 回復